Understanding the Impact

Fleas aren't just a nuisance; they can cause a lot of discomfort for your pregnant pup. Imagine being pregnant and having tiny, pesky bugs biting you all day. It's no fun! Fleas can lead to skin irritation, allergic reactions, and even anemia in severe cases. Plus, they can be a pain to get rid of, especially when your pet is pregnant.

Prevention is Key

Preventing fleas is better than dealing with an infestation. Keep your home clean, vacuum regularly, and wash your pup's bedding frequently. Also, consider using natural deterrents like essential oils or diatomaceous earth around your home.

When Fleas Strike

First things first, don't panic. Fleas can be a real pain, but they're not impossible to handle. Here's what you can do:

  • Check for Fleas: Gently comb through your pup's fur to look for fleas or their eggs. They're tiny, but you might spot them if you look closely.
  • Consult Your Vet: Before you do anything, talk to your vet. They can recommend safe and effective treatments for your pregnant pup.
  • Use Flea Shampoos and Sprays: Your vet might suggest a special flea shampoo or spray that's safe for pregnant dogs. Follow the instructions carefully.
  • Keep the Environment Clean: Vacuum your home regularly and wash your pup's bedding in hot water. You might also want to steam clean your carpets and furniture.
  • Consider Natural Remedies: Some pet owners opt for natural remedies like apple cider vinegar or brewer's yeast. However, always consult your vet before trying these methods.

Special Care for Pregnant Pups

When dealing with fleas during pregnancy, it's crucial to be extra careful. Here are a few things to keep in mind:

  • Avoid Over-the-Counter Treatments: Some flea treatments can be harmful to pregnant dogs. Always use products recommended by your vet.
  • Monitor Your Pup's Health: Keep an eye on your pup for signs of discomfort or illness. If you notice anything unusual, contact your vet immediately.
